Sam Westrop (Part II)

Sep 8, 2020

Sam Westrop

Sam Westrop returns to Common Threads this week to continue our conversation from last week. Sam is the director of Islamist Watch. He's here to help us understand the threat of Islamism to non-Muslims and Muslims.

Sam Westrop has headed Islamist Watch since March 2017. Prior to this he was research director at Americans for Peace and Tolerance, and ran Stand for Peace, a London-based counter-extremism organization monitoring Islamists throughout the UK. Mr. Westrop is a senior fellow at the Gatestone Institute. His writings have appeared at such publications as National Review, National Post, and The Hill, and he has appeared on dozens of television and radio stations, including BBC, Al Jazeera, and Newsmax.